Hello,

I am running my own server which runs with Mindcrack (v8.2.0) plus everything from the Direwolf20 (v5.2.1) pack.

I am having an issue on my server where, possibly due to lag, blocks broken by a Buildcraft filler appear on the ground briefly before seeming to shoot in the direction of the Filler block itself, never to be seen again.

I use fillers as clearers and farmers, and I don't understand why this server is having such an issue. In the configuration files, the settings make sure that the Filler breaks blocks and does not destroy them. Everything should be dropping as normal.

Is there anything I can do to troubleshoot this? Thanks in advance, guys.

fillers were fixed a while back to stop people useing them as cheap quarrys now items desapwn almost instantly and the lines in config disabled so it cannot be changed

Originally, it was configurable to have the filler destroy items. No one used it this way and it started to replace the quarry when YouTubers started showcasing it as the next great thing (Which the mod author stated was not the intended use of the Filler) so he made it so the filler was used as intended and those looking for a quarry would be pressed into a quarry or "other" mass mining device. I don't get the impression that mod authors care to make something configurable, if they specifically don't want it used for that purpose.

The feature was removed because it caused a massive amount of entities and block updates which killed servers. Why would you want something like this?
